Wealth of world’s billionaires grew by $2tn in 2024, with UK leading the way in G7!

Number of billionaires rose by 204 to 2,769.Their wealth jumped from $13tn to $15tn – the second-largest annual increase since records began.

TAX THE SUPER RICH

www.theguardian.com/news/2025/ja...
Wealth of world’s billionaires grew by $2tn in 2024, report finds
Rate of wealth growth last year was three times faster than 2023, Oxfam inequality research reveals
